Sail Boat Heart



I don't know if you can tell from the photo, but I carved a sailboat on this heart.

The balance for this heart is a little off, it's difficult to stand it up on it's own because I tried using a different tool to try and flatten the bottom, but it didn't work very well. I carved the boat out and tried to make each part of the boat a different depth and pattern, which didn't work for the flags, but it still looks pretty.

This heart actually took me about four hours, because I was trying to be careful with shaping the boat, so it took me a little longer, but I like the outcome. The glaze is one of my new favorites, I don't remember what it's called though, but it has little crystal spots that looks like snow flakes, and the color is really soft and calming.

The hardest part was trying to make all of the parts of the boats look clean and even. I took an extra class just to make it smooth, but it was totally worth it!
